What are Sapphire Ear Studs?
Sapphire ear studs, at their core, are earrings featuring sapphires as the primary gemstone, typically set in a stud or post-back design. This classic style offers versatility, making it suitable for both everyday wear and special occasions. Sapphires, a variety of the mineral corundum, are renowned for their exceptional hardness (ranking 9 on the Mohs scale), second only to diamonds, which makes them incredibly durable for jewelry that is worn frequently. While often associated with a deep blue color, sapphires actually occur in a stunning array of colors, including pink, yellow, green, and even colorless (white sapphire), though the blue variety remains the most iconic and sought-after. The ‘ear stud’ design is minimalist yet impactful, usually featuring a single gemstone or a small cluster, often secured by a post that passes through the earlobe and is fastened with a butterfly or screw-back clasp. The appeal lies in their ability to catch the light beautifully, offering a subtle yet undeniable sparkle that enhances any ensemble. The Allure of Blue Sapphires
The deep, captivating blue of sapphire has long been associated with royalty, wisdom, and divine favor. This timeless appeal makes blue sapphire ear studs a perennial favorite. In Indian culture, blue is also a significant color, often linked to deities like Lord Krishna and Lord Vishnu, adding a layer of spiritual and cultural resonance to blue gemstones. The intensity and shade of blue can vary significantly, from a pale sky blue to a rich, velvety royal blue, with the latter often being the most prized. The ‘cornflower blue’ variety, a medium-deep blue with a slight violet undertone, is particularly coveted. Beyond Blue: Exploring Other Sapphire Colors
While blue sapphires steal the spotlight, the fascinating world of fancy sapphires offers a spectrum of captivating hues. Pink sapphires, often associated with romance and compassion, have gained immense popularity. Yellow sapphires symbolize prosperity and intellect, making them a favored choice for those seeking financial success and mental acuity, aligning with the commercial spirit found in cities like Jaipur. Green sapphires represent harmony and balance, while orange and pinkish-orange ‘padparadscha’ sapphires, considered among the rarest and most valuable, are revered for their unique beauty and association with serenity. Understanding the 4 Cs (Color, Clarity, Cut, Carat)
Similar to diamonds, sapphires are evaluated based on four primary characteristics:
- Color: This is the most critical factor for sapphires. The most desirable color is a pure, vivid blue (often called royal blue or cornflower blue) with even saturation. While color intensity is key, personal preference plays a significant role; some may prefer a lighter or darker shade.
- Clarity: Sapphires are graded on their clarity, with fewer visible inclusions being better. However, minor inclusions are natural and can even be a sign of authenticity. Eye-clean sapphires, where inclusions are not visible to the naked eye, are highly valued.
- Cut: A well-cut sapphire will maximize its brilliance, sparkle, and color. The cut should be symmetrical and proportionate, ensuring the stone looks its best. The skill of the lapidary (gem cutter) is crucial here.
- Carat: This refers to the weight of the gemstone. Larger sapphires are rarer and thus more expensive per carat. The size of the ear studs will depend on your preference and budget.
Metal Settings and Styles
The metal setting plays a significant role in the overall appearance and durability of sapphire ear studs. Common choices include:
- Yellow Gold: A classic choice that complements the blue of sapphires beautifully, offering a warm contrast. Available in 14K or 18K.
- White Gold: Provides a modern and sleek look, making the blue of the sapphire stand out. It’s an alloy of gold and white metals, often plated with rhodium for extra shine and durability.
- Platinum: A naturally white, strong, and hypoallergenic metal. It is more expensive than gold but offers exceptional durability and a luxurious feel.
- Rose Gold: Offers a romantic and trendy aesthetic, creating a unique contrast with blue sapphires.
Styles range from simple solitaire studs to halo designs (where smaller diamonds or other gemstones surround the central sapphire) and cluster settings. Consider the intended use: simple solitaires are perfect for everyday wear, while halo or cluster designs offer more glamour for special occasions.
Budget Considerations
The price of sapphire ear studs can vary widely based on the quality of the sapphires (color, clarity, size), the metal used, and the craftsmanship. Sapphires sourced from regions known for exceptional quality, like Kashmir (historically) or certain origins in Sri Lanka and Myanmar, often command higher prices.
